Matthew 22:30-32
Disciples’ Literal New Testament
30 For in the resurrection, they neither marry nor are given-in-marriage, but are like angels[a] in heaven. 31 And concerning the resurrection of the dead, did you not read the thing having been spoken to you by God[b], saying [in Ex 3:15] 32 ‘I am the God of Abraham, and the God of Isaac, and the God of Jacob’? He is not the God of dead ones, but of living ones”.

- Matthew 22:30 That is, not subject to death (and so not needing to marry and procreate), and members of God’s family, not separate families. See Lk 20:36.
- Matthew 22:31 God spoke to you about the resurrection when He said ‘I am the God of Abraham’.
Matthew 22:30-32
New International Version
30 At the resurrection people will neither marry nor be given in marriage;(A) they will be like the angels in heaven. 31 But about the resurrection of the dead—have you not read what God said to you, 32 ‘I am the God of Abraham, the God of Isaac, and the God of Jacob’[a]?(B) He is not the God of the dead but of the living.”
